Atlas® is an innovative, customer-oriented provider of asphalt shingles, roof underlayments, rigid expanded polystyrene, and polyiso insulation, geofoam, cold chain, protective packaging, lost foam, and cutting-edge coated and paper facers and underlayments for a diverse set of markets. Atlas has grown from a single asphalt shingle manufacturing facility to 36 facilities in North America with worldwide product distribution. Products from the company's four major divisions, Polyiso Roof & Wall Insulation, Shingle & Underlayment, Molded Products, and Web Technologies, are manufactured in state-of-the-art facilities and shipped from its network of manufacturing plants and distribution facilities in the United States, Canada, and Mexico. Atlas Molded Products specializes in the development and manufacture of innovative, high performance molded polystyrene for architectural insulation, geofoam, protective packaging, cold chain packaging, and industrial OEM applications.
With plants across the United States, Atlas Molded Products can provide product solutions coast-to-coast. When combining block molding and shape molding, Atlas Molded Products has the most extensive polystyrene processing capabilities in the United States and maintains the highest standards of excellence in products, quality, and customer service.

Production Associate Primary Responsibilities
  • Report to Manager at shift start for direction for the day.
  • General understanding of the manufacturing processes, quality standards, equipment operations, safety requirements and departmental procedures.
  • Inspect and package parts according to specification pages and record required information on in-process sheets.
  • Bundles, wraps, stacks, packs, assemble and/or labels materials per specific production instructions.
  • Operates side-wrappers and pallet jacks.
  • Maintains a clean and organized work area.
  • Knowledge of and ability to operate Pre-breakers / Re-Grinding equipment to recycle EPS.
  • Must be trained and familiar with general safety.

Production Associate Experience
  • Prior experience in a manufacturing / industrial environment preferred

Production Associate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
  • Fluent in the English language, both written and spoken, preferred.
  • Must be able to use simple math, count and use basic hand-held measuring tools.

Production Associate Education, Licenses & Certifications
  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ED) preferred

Production Associate Additional Information
  • Light to moderate physical effort required including sitting, standing, walking, kneeling, squatting, climbing steps or ladders, grasping, fine and course manipulation, reaching both forward and above head level, and tolerant of temperature changes for the entire shift.
  • Must be able to push, pull and/or lift up to 50 pounds; and safely operate assigned machinery.
